Output 89afb0d7ef935ff20a66559177173cf0e23a26c187222cd5758c04152092d14a:1

value
2737783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b3b280874f02f3fe35570bc5f34c4c6270896b0 OP_EQUAL
address
3BU16KutGurkgQxor3iLJe7aVZiM3aiy7W
transaction
89afb0d7ef935ff20a66559177173cf0e23a26c187222cd5758c04152092d14a
spent
true